In this episode of the Badass Agile podcast, titled "Employee Mindset," I explore the challenges and limitations that the current corporate approach to Agile presents. I dive into how Agile has transformed from a dynamic framework into a rule-bound guidebook that often prioritizes pleasing corporate structures over innovation. Throughout the episode, I examine the issues brought about by the "employee mindset" and its focus on maintaining the status quo. I challenge listeners to embrace an agile spirit that favors experimentation, flexibility, and a willingness to break free from rigid frameworks. The conversation also addresses the need to help Agile teams focus on value creation and client impact, rather than adhering strictly to prescribed processes. I invite everyone to rethink their approach to Agile and to prioritize outcomes and impact over traditional rule-following. This episode encourages listeners to let go of the fear of failure and to cultivate a bold, adventurous spirit in the pursuit of excellence and service.
